Overview

Built for bass anglers working baitfish-style presentations, this jig offers a full silicone skirt that can be fished as-is or trimmed to match a preferred profile. The Bio-Flex skirt colors are presented in exclusive combinations, and the design includes double rattles that can be removed if not wanted. A Mustad UltraPoint hook with an 18-degree bend and an inline hook eye is paired with a head molded for use around dense vegetation, making it a practical choice for wood and structure.

Considerations & Trade-offs

  • The skirt is intentionally full and thick, so anglers who prefer a slimmer profile may want to trim it before fishing.
  • Double rattles are included, but they can be removed if a quieter presentation is needed.
  • The jig is described for bass fishing and for targeting wood and structure, so it is a more specialized option than a general-purpose jig.
  • The product information lists 50 strands in the description and 30 strands in the specifications, so the exact skirt strand count should be verified before purchase.
